Tiffany & Co. is perhaps the world’s most iconic jeweler. Founded in 1837 by Charles Lewis Tiffany, focusing on stationary and other “fancy goods”, they soon moved to focus on jewelry and timepieces and by 1870 built a new store described as “a palace of jewels” by the New York Times. Charles Louis Tiffany earned the nickname “The King of Diamonds” in 1887 when he purchased one-third of the French Crown Jewels. Much later, the company reestablished itself as the lodestar of luxury after unveiling The Tiffany Diamond, a roughly 287 ct. yellow diamond that was cut into a stunning 128 ct. gem and worn by Audry Hepburn to promote Breakfast at Tiffany’s in 1961. If a diamond is forever, Tiffany & Co. jewelry and timepieces must be similarly timeless.
